The first message is in the FAQ (but looks irrelevent?)

The error says the db connection is broken. In fact, the part you posted is where
it is trying to close the connection because it encountered a problem.

P.S. As I've said many times, you don't need an XA connection for JBossMQ persistence,
there is only ever one branch to the JBossMQ internal transaction.
If you want JMS XA, use the JMS Resource Adapter (FAQ again).
